Sixth suspect in Georgia fair shooting arrested

SAVANNAH, Ga. (AP) — Police have arrested the sixth man who was wanted in connection with a shooting at a fair in Savannah that left eight people injured.

Savannah-Chatham police Wednesday arrested 21-year-old Lajuan Jerome Sloman for his involvement in the shootout at the Coastal Empire Fair on Nov. 3.

Authorities say Sloman was one of two shooters and is charged with eight counts of aggravated assault and one count of lying to police to impede their investigation.

Another man, 23-year-old Terrance Lasalle Thacker Jr. was arrested Monday for lying to police about the incident.

Four others — including the man who returned fire at Sloman — have already been taken into custody.
